Early Childhood Toddler Teacher

Company Overview
Capitol Child Development Center, Inc. is a dedicated non-profit early care and education center with over 27 years of experience. We specialize in providing high-quality Infant, Toddler, and Preschool care for up to 72 children, committed to fostering a nurturing and educational environment that meets the highest national standards through accreditation by the National Association for the Education of Young Children (NAEYC).

Job Overview
We are seeking an energetic and passionate Early Childhood Toddler Teacher to join our vibrant team. In this role, you will inspire young learners through engaging lesson plans, support their developmental milestones, and create a safe, stimulating classroom environment. Your enthusiasm and expertise will help lay the foundation for lifelong learning and curiosity in our toddlers.

Responsibilities

  • Develop and implement age-appropriate curriculum tailored to toddler development stages, incorporating literacy education, and early intervention strategies applicable
  • Foster a positive classroom atmosphere through effective classroom management and behavior management techniques
  • Support children's social-emotional growth by promoting healthy interactions and child welfare practices
  • Plan and execute engaging activities that promote physical development, early childhood education skills, and basic math concepts
  • Maintain detailed documentation of each child's progress, including assessments aligned with CT Early Learning and Development Standards (ELDS)
  • Collaborate closely with families to build strong partnerships and communicate children's progress effectively
  • Ensure a safe, clean, and organized classroom environment that adheres to licensing regulations and best practices in early learning settings

Experience

  • Associates Degree in Early Childhood Education is required; Bachelors degree in ECE preferred
  • Prior classroom experience working with children in a childcare setting is required
  • Experience in curriculum development, lesson planning, and classroom management is essential
  • Knowledge of special education needs, early intervention techniques, and behavior management strategies is highly desirable
  • Demonstrated ability to work effectively with toddlers, supporting their physical, cognitive, and social emotional growth
  • Strong communication skills for engaging with children, families, and team members effectively
  • Background in early childhood education or related fields is required
  • Familiarity with childhood development milestones will enhance your impact in this role
  • Supervisory experience a plus

Pay: $18.00 - $20.00 per hour
